After Gambhir, Kohli lashes out at Afridi over his Kashmir tweet
Shahid Afridi’s post on the recent wave of bloodshed in Indian held Kashmir that claimed dozens of lives at the hands of Indian armed forces have drawn ire from India, as cricketers from the other side of the border continue to criticize the Pakistani star all-rounder. Indian skipper Virat Kohli was the latest to join the bandwagon of Indian cricketers and lashed out at Afridi for raising his voice against the atrocities of Indian armed forces. "As an Indian you want to express what is best for your nation and my interests are always for the benefit of our nation. If anything opposes it, I would never support it for sure," ANI quoted Kohli as saying. "But having said that, it's a very personal choice for someone to comment about certain issues. Unless I have total knowledge of the issues and the intricacies of it I don't engage in it but definitely your priority stays with your nation," he added. We respect all.
